Ben Jonson’s "Volpone, or the Fox": A Retelling
Descrizione dell’editore
Ben Jonson was a master of satire who ranks with Jonathan Swift and Voltaire. In Volpone, he tackles greed. The wealthy Venetian gentleman Volpone is as cunning as a fox, and he pretends to be very ill and dying in order to entice legacy-hunters to give him valuable gifts in hopes of being named his heir. This works well for three years, but then …
This is an easy-to-read retelling of Ben Jonson's satiric masterpiece: "Volpone, or the Fox."
